I brought home a ladybug (in the south of Sweden) and out came a small larvae that turned into a little fly. After doing some research and reading some of the threads on this forum I have found out that Medina separata prefers ladybugs. Is it possible to id it from these photos?

Nice work, Monsum. It is the male of Medina separata indeed. You can very nicely see the tuft of hairs on the ventral side at the genitalia ! Theo |
